Note on Husband: James Wright
On 21st August 1865 James goes to Mr Clarkes School at Lapford
Diary note - James Wright Junr son of James and Ellen Wright injured his eye in a field near Trowbridge, Crediton occupied by John Carthew August 4 1866.
MMB has made a diary note against March 28 in John Pickett's daybooks. - James Wright-first accident took place 1891 at Sir John Shelley sawmills Shobrooke Park.
By 1891 seems to have moved to Crediton, North Street, married and at census time his mother is living with them. This was within one week of his accident, and no doubt she was assisting with his care.
James left Crediton for Middlesborough on August 23rd 1896 to reside with his wife, according to a note in MMB's diary
At 1901 he is a widower living in Yorkshire with his wife's family.10
Note on Wife: Jane Coulson
At 1871 census she was Lady's Maid at Wadworth, Yorkshire, to Amelia Bower. She gives her birthplace variously as Swainby, Middleton and Whorlton.
MMB's diary entry for Dec 24th - Jane Wright nee Coulson wife of James Wright died at 72 Granville Rd M-bro North Yorks 1900 and interred at Guisborough Cemetery, North Yorks
